D-Link no longer actively develops new features for the DSL-2750U C1, but they have released several important stability updates over its lifecycle.


The hardware version H W C1 of the D-Link DSL-2750U indicates a specific iteration of the device, which may have particular firmware requirements or features distinct from other versions. It's crucial to use firmware that matches your hardware version to avoid compatibility issues.

    Based on user reports and changelogs, here is what you can expect:

    | Version | Release Date | Key Improvements / Fixes |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| 1.00 | 2013 | Initial release. Buggy Wi-Fi, poor uptime. | | 1.02 | 2013 | Fixed PPPoE reconnection issues. | | 1.04 | 2014 | Added WPA2-PSK with TKIP+AES stability. | | 1.06 | 2015 | Most stable. Fixed NAT table overflow and DNS relay crashes. | | 1.08 | 2016 (rare) | Minor security patch. No feature changes. |

    Recommendation: If you are on version 1.04 or older, upgrade to 1.06. Avoid 1.08 unless you need a specific security fix mentioned in the advisory.
